Grilled Teriyaki Tofu

Serves 4
Time 1 hr 10 min
Grilled Teriyaki Tofu

Teriyaki-marinated tofu is a versatile ingredient for vegetarians. Use in sandwiches or wraps, or serve on a bed of sautéed veggies like spinach, carrots, bok choy or bell peppers.

Ingredients

    1/4 cuplow-sodium tamari
    2 teaspoonssesame oil
    1 tablespoonhoney
    1 tablespoonrice vinegar
    1 teaspoongrated fresh ginger
    1 teaspoon finely chopped garlic
    Olive oil cooking spray
    1 package (14-ounce)extra-firm tofu, drained and patted dry, cut crosswise into 8 slices

Method

In a wide, shallow dish, whisk together tamari, sesame oil, honey, rice vinegar, ginger and garlic.


Add tofu, turn to coat all over, cover and chill for at least 1 hour or overnight.


Pat tofu dry, then coat lightly with cooking spray.


Grill over medium-high heat or broil on a foil-lined baking sheet until golden brown, 3 to 5 minutes on each side.
